Considerations for Specific Uses
While the Wild Buffalo Embroidery Design is generally versatile, there are specific scenarios where extra care is needed:
- Small Patch Sizes: The intricate details may not translate well at very small sizes. Test the design in black and white first to ensure clarity.
- Cap Fronts and Curved Surfaces: The design should be carefully positioned to avoid distortion on curved surfaces like cap fronts.
- High Stitch Density and Detailed Outlines: Ensure the stitch density is appropriate for the fabric and that detailed outlines do not become too dense, which can affect the overall look and feel.
- Textured Fabric and Dark Uniforms: The design may need adjustments for visibility on textured or dark fabrics. Consider using high-contrast thread colors.
- Frequent Washing: For items that will be washed frequently, such as aprons and work shirts, use a durable stabilizer to maintain the design's integrity over time.

Practical Embroidery Designer Notes
To ensure the best results when using the Wild Buffalo Embroidery Design for your business, consider the following tips:
- Test in Black and White: Start by testing the design in black and white to check for clarity and detail visibility.
- Check Small Patch Size: Evaluate the design at the smallest intended size to ensure all elements are clear and distinct.
- Thread Color Contrast: Choose thread colors that provide good contrast against the fabric, especially for dark or textured materials.
- Spacing and Alignment: Carefully inspect the spacing and alignment of design elements, especially for uniform and cap embroidery.
- Hoop Size and Stabilizer: Use the appropriate hoop size and stabilizer for the fabric type and design complexity.
- Real Fabric Testing: Always test the design on the actual fabric you plan to use to see how it behaves in real-world conditions.
- Mockup for Client Approval: Create a printable mockup to show clients and get their approval before final production.
- Design Assets Comparison: Compare the Wild Buffalo Embroidery Design with other design assets to ensure visual consistency across all branded items.
- Commercial Licensing: Confirm that the design is licensed for commercial use before incorporating it into your business products.
